The book of Zephaniah is a reminder to us that God has always been and always will be deeply involved in our lives. Zephaniah, the prophet recognized the sin around him. God had told him of the impending judgment against Israel and the surrounding nations. He knew that sin demands judgment but he also knew that God is merciful and eager to forgive and ultimately that God's love for all mankind is awesome!

Hebrew meaning of Zephaniah 3:17

In the context of our verse, Zephaniah 3:17 the meaning of the phrase "rejoice over you" literally means "dance, skip, leap and spin around in joy." God dances over us!


The word "rejoice" is translated from a Hebrew word that Strongs defines as:

A primitive root; properly to spin around (under the influence of any violent emotion), that is, usually rejoice…: – be glad, joy, be joyful, rejoice.

The Hebrew word means to “spin around under violent emotion,” or basically to dance.

The Lord Your God Is With You He Is Mighty To Save

God is all-powerful. God is the creator of the heavens and the earth. He is the almighty God and He saves His people once we have put our trust in Him. God has restored us to eternal life through His Son, Jesus.


But there is more!


God is with us in our daily lives. He is there with us through the highs and the lows of all that comes our way. We are promised God's protection when we are hidden in Him (Psalm 91) God is the Powerful One who wins our battles. He is our protector and defender and as such, He is our victorious warrior.  Our triumphant Saviour Who is mighty to save.
